Criminal convictions for corruption and influence peddling in telecommunications contracts in Algeria [ZTE Corporation - Huawei Technologies ]
On 6 June 2012, three Chinese nationals, employees of ZTE Algérie et Huawei Algérie, subsidiaries of the Chinese telecommunications companies ZTE and Huawei, were convicted of influence trafficking by Judge Saloua Derbouchi in the Algerian court. The men, Xiao Chunfa of Huawei and Chen Zhibao and Dong Tao of ZTE, were sentenced in absentia to ten years in prison, and fined approximately USD 65,000.

Chinese firm helps Iran spy on citizens (ZTE Corporation)
A Chinese telecommunications equipment company has sold Iran's largest telecom firm a powerful surveillance system capable of monitoring landline, mobile and internet communications, interviews and contract documents show...

Chinese company 'sacked worker after sex harassment complaint'
CHINESE-OWNED mobile handset manufacturer ZTE threatened to send an employee from its Melbourne offices back to China after she complained about sexual harassment, according to an unfair-dismissal claim lodged with the Federal Court in Victoria.

China's ZTE wins two contracts despite corruption allegations
Despite mounting allegations of corruption and criticism of illegally bringing Chinese foreign nationals to work on its telecom projects in Africa, China's ZTE has been awarded contracts to build nationwide fiber networks in South Africa and Burundi.
